Transaction 34a678e2b5e9a1f6a01f11bf125ccf97685d344cfd26a6df1db2cee8eb4623a7

3 Input
1 Outputs
  • 34a678e2b5e9a1f6a01f11bf125ccf97685d344cfd26a6df1db2cee8eb4623a7:0
  • value  175176
    address  1FgWKfz3mpn9MycmL7epaZt9CVEV7Lf215